If you’ve ever wandered down 12th Main Road in Indiranagar on a busy evening, chances are you’ve passed Araku, a coffee shop. Right opposite to it is The Reservoire, a place where the vibes meet the views. Decided to step in and spend an evening at their 4th-floor rooftop, and let me tell you, it wasn’t just a meal or a drink. It was an experience.
The elevator doors opened, and I was greeted with that perfect wooden door with the massive R logo on it, and then came a canopy of soft lights, lush vertical gardens, and the low thrum of music setting the mood. There’s something about open-air seating under the evening sky that instantly makes conversations flow better and drinks taste sweeter.
The indoor areas feature a mix of lounge-style seating and high bar stools, perfect for both deep conversations and casual catch-ups. The ambiance leans into cozy without being too dim, thanks to warm lighting that glows just right, casting a soft, amber tone over the room. The textured walls were playful, surrounded by tasteful decor. It’s the space where you can sink into a plush seat and let time stretch a little longer than usual.
Whether you’re catching up with a friend or finding a quiet spot for yourself, the indoor seating at The Reservoire wraps you in a vibe that’s both welcoming and stylish.
I’m not one to exaggerate when it comes to cocktails, but The Reservoire’s bar? It’s in a league of its own. With over 200 choices. After a glance at the drinks menu, I went with their Elderflower Blueberry Gin Cocktail. It’s floral, fruity, and refreshing, perfect for a rooftop evening. Pretty fabulous.


We went in hungry and ordered a little bit — the sushi (comfort food on another level), their chicken crisps (crisp, flavorful, and gone in minutes), and some clear chicken soup that hit the right cozy feels. Every dish seemed honest and warm, making it even more enjoyable.

Dessert
Sweet Endings That Hit the Spot
No visit to The Reservoire is truly complete without dipping into their dessert menu. And trust me, it’s worth saving space for. I ended my evening on a high (sugar) note with a few standout treats.
The Brownie Lasagne with Ice Cream (yes, it’s eggless!) was layers of fudgy brownie and tangy cream cheese, served warm with a scoop of ice cream that melted into every bite. Then there was the Jack Daniels Chocolate Cake, a signature indulgence where rich, molten chocolate is subtly infused with the smokiness of whiskey, deep and seriously spellbinding.
For something lighter but equally luscious, the Tres Leches Cake brought soft sponge soaked in three types of milk — airy, creamy, and perfectly sweet. The classics weren’t far behind: a Walnut Chocolate Brownie with just the right crunch, and a slice of their Eggless Red Velvet Cake, velvety smooth and crowned with a gentle swirl of frosting. Each dessert felt like a little celebration, whether you’re sharing or not (I didn’t).

Location: 3rd & 4th Floor, No. 949, 12th Main Road, Indiranagar, Bangalore.
Open: 11:30 AM – 1:00 AM
